Background

Growth on the south side of Joplin overloaded the outdated original Shoal Creek WWTP. The City needed a new treatment plant. In the mid-1980’s, the Shoal Creek Wastewater Treatment Plant was relocated to a new site southwest of Joplin. Allgeier Martin AMA designed for the construction of a new facility with a 6.5 MGD average flow and 15 MGD peak flow. The plant needed more capacity for biological treatment and sludge handling. This was due to stricter regulations.

Shoal Creek Wastewater Treatment Plant

Activity

The City again looked to Allgeier Martin to plan and design this relocated wastewater treatment plant. In 1988, the Shoal Creek Wastewater Treatment Plant (WWTP) was constructed and put into operation. Once the regulations on BOD and suspended solids tightened, Allgeier Martin was again hired to plan and design improvements in 2010.

As part of the 1988 project, approximately 4 miles of gravity sewer and 2.4 miles of pressure sewer were constructed. The system includes three flow equalization basins that allow for cost-effective design, construction and operation.

Technical Design & Features

1988

  • 6.5 MGD average flow & 15 MGD peak flow
  • Trickling filter tower with anaerobic sludge digestion
  • 12 MGD raw sewage lift station with aerated grit removal & comminution
  • Constructed approx. 4 miles of 21”- 42” gravity sewer lines
  • Constructed approx. 2.4 miles of 24” pressure sewer line
  • 3 flow equalization basins allow for cost-effective design/construction/operation

2016

  • Added activated sludge facilities, clarifiers, effluent filters & ultraviolet disinfection
  • Aerobic sludge digesters, gravity belt thickener & related sludge handling equipment improve sludge stabilization and land application operations
  • Funded through local bond issue & State Revolving Fund program
